- I like the level of service that I get right now. I can't say I
- understand _why_ this level of service needs to change. Will SIGGRAPH
- change its rate structure for exhibitors and attendees at the annual
- conference? If not, what _will_ become of the excess income? I don't
- think it's appropriate for that money to go to the general treasury.
-
- Assuming things _have_ to change, I wouls say that the appropriate
- level is whatever is necessary to match current services, i.e.,
- Computer Graphics plus Conference proceedings. Make the CD-ROM
- available at additional cost, along with ancillary conference
- proceedings, SIGGRAPH revues, etc.
